Lewes Exiles |
Martin Carthy heads the list of the great and good of British folk music who
take a reduced fee to perform at The Royal Oak in Lewes, one of the
longest-running folk clubs in the country. This is due in large measure to
Vic & Tina Smith’s unswerving commitment to our native music, together with
co-resident musicians of the highest calibre, some or all of whom will be
performing on the night. |
